I am just wondering if the intended boss difficulty is 'stack lightning resist above 90% or spam from off screen'. That is not real difficulty, and that is what this fight is currently. This is also how the crematorium piety fight felt, boring ass stat check. Got max light resist? Nope, okay you're dead. Ohhh, you do? Simple. Now its just elevated to needing 90+% resist rather than 75%. If this is the intention, I guess I will just accept that, but I really think GGG can do better than arbitrary resist checks of this magnitude.
We see a similar mechanic with Merveil and her unavoidable Cold Snap, but the damage difference is insane. I would assume from fighting them that Piety on Temple does at least 10x the damage that Merveil does on the Graveyard Map. With 83% cold resist merveil didn't scratch me with Cold Snap, with 83% lightning resist I died instantly to Piety on the first encounter.
